Higher One ranked No. 12 on business magazine's 'Hot 100 List'
Higher One, a financial services company that focuses on higher education, has made Entrepreneur Magazine’s “Hot 100 List” of the country’s fastest growing businesses. The New Haven, Conn. company, number 12 on the list, was chosen for its increased sales and job growth. For the last three years, Higher One has grown at an annual rate of 95%.

In 2007, Higher One reached agreements to partner with 28 colleges and universities serving 270,000 students, to distribute refunds through OneDisburse Refund Management. During the first four months of 2008, Higher One has finalized partnerships with 15 more higher education institutions representing more than 173,000 students.
Higher One’s Refund Management disbursement service helps schools by streamlining the process in which all disbursements and reconciliations are managed electronically. The schools benefit from the elimination of time-consuming functions, paper checks and errors while realizing a cost savings.
